Appsecure logo

CVE-2025-55006: Medium Vulnerability in Frappe Learning

A medium severity vulnerability in Frappe Learning allows for potential script execution via malicious SVG uploads. Organizations should address this issue by upgrading to version 2.34.0 to prevent exploitation.

MEDIUMCVSS 4.3 · Published August 9, 2025

Not a customer? See how AppSecure simulates real world attacks to protect your infrastructure.

Speak to Experts

Frappe Learning is a learning system that helps users structure their content. In versions 2.33.0 and below, the image upload functionality did not adequately sanitize uploaded SVG files. This allowed users to upload SVG files containing embedded JavaScript or other potentially malicious content. Malicious SVG files could be used to execute arbitrary scripts in the context of other users. A fix for this issue is planned for version 2.34.0.

The CVSS score for this vulnerability is 4.3, classified as medium severity. This score indicates a moderate level of risk to organizations using the affected software, particularly those that allow user uploads of SVG files.

Risk to organizations includes the potential for unauthorized script execution, which can lead to data breaches or other malicious activities. Therefore, organizations should prioritize patching immediately.

Currently, there are no known exploits or proof-of-concept (PoC) code available for this vulnerability. However, the lack of existing exploits does not diminish the importance of remediation.

Organizations should address this vulnerability by upgrading to version 2.34.0 of Frappe Learning as soon as it is available to mitigate potential risks.

Vulnerability Details

The vulnerability allows for the uploading of malicious SVG files due to insufficient sanitization. The attack vector is network-based, requiring high privileges and user interaction.

Technical Analysis

The root cause of this vulnerability is the inadequate sanitation of SVG files during upload. Attackers can exploit this by uploading crafted SVG files that contain malicious JavaScript. The attack complexity is low, but it requires a user with high privileges to upload the file.

Risk & Impact Analysis

The real-world deployment risk is significant, as malicious SVG files could lead to unauthorized script execution, affecting the confidentiality, integrity, and availability of user data. Organizations must understand the potential blast radius of this vulnerability and address it promptly. Given the CVSS score and the potential impact on users, organizations should address this in their priority patch cycle.

Exploitation Status

Signal

Status

Known Exploit

No

Public PoC

No

Actively Exploited

No

Ransomware Use

No

Affected Versions

All versions prior to vendor patch 2.34.0 are affected.

Mitigation & Remediation

Organizations should upgrade to version 2.34.0 of Frappe Learning as soon as it is released. In the meantime, consider configuring validation for uploaded files and implementing strict network controls to mitigate the risk of this vulnerability. For further guidance, organizations can benefit from application security assessments to identify weaknesses in their systems.

Detection Guidance

Monitor logs for unusual file uploads, especially for SVG files. Implement behavioral anomaly detection to identify any unauthorized script execution. Additionally, keep an eye on network signatures that might indicate an exploitation attempt.

AppSecure Threat Intelligence Insight

This vulnerability highlights the importance of proper file handling and validation in web applications. As organizations increasingly rely on user-generated content, understanding and mitigating such vulnerabilities becomes critical. Security teams should consider reviewing their file upload processes and implementing comprehensive security measures. For more information on improving application security, organizations can refer to vulnerability management programs and explore penetration testing methodologies to uncover other potential weaknesses.

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

Latest CVEs. Recently published vulnerabilities from the NVD database.

View all vulnerabilities
CVE IDSeverity
CVE-2025-65418HIGH
CVE-2025-65417MEDIUM
CVE-2025-65416MEDIUM
CVE-2025-65415MEDIUM
CVE-2025-61314HIGH

Protect Your Business with Hacker-Focused Approach.